On Fri, 11 Jun 2004, Paul Jarc wrote:
> FWIW, I'd prefer -R or a new option. (Even then, I'm not really happy
> with the fact that $GREP_OPTIONS could break a script. But I suppose
> it can already break scripts in different ways.)
Sure it can... show me a script that always behaves correctly, no matter
how I set LANG, LC_*, SHELL, SHELLOPTS, IFS, USER, HOME, _POSIXLY_CORRECT,
_POSIX2_VERSION and a bunch of other variables... it's kind of impossible.
Scripts always assume that you have a reasonable set of env vars.
